Place ring compressor (22) and
piston and connecting rod
assembly (5) on liner (1) with
numbers on side of connecting
rod and cap alined with
matchmark on liner.
Push piston and connecting rod
assemblv (5) down into liner until
piston is-free of ring compressor
(22).
CAUTION
Do not force piston into liner.
Expanders apply considerable force
on oil rings; therefore, take care
during loading operation to prevent
ring breakage.
(h) Remove connecting rod cap and
ring compressor. Then push
piston down until compression
rings pass cylinder liner ports.
h. Installation - Cylinder Klt Assembly
NOTE
If any pistons and liners are already
in engine, use hold down clamps
(23) to retain liners (1) in place
when rotating crankshaft.
(1) Install cylinder liner insert (24) in
block counterbore.
(2) Rotate crankshaft (25) until
connecting rod journal (26) of cylinder
is at bottom of its travel. Wipe journal
clean and lubricate with clean engine
oil.
